74: Windows on the Duo Core - Boot Camp

We strongly recommend that you bring your laptop to the iCare Corner and let us install Windows on your Apple laptop.

If you choose to load Windows on the duo core processor machine, be sure to follow the directions for Boot Camp. You will need a blank CD to load drivers on to and you will need to partition your drive according to instructions in Boot Camp. The entire set-up process is described in the Boot Camp instructions and can take up to four hours.


Once you have loaded the Windows operating system, it will appear as a second hard drive on your desktop, usually called NO NAME or UNTITLED. DO NOT TRASH, MOVE, or REMOVE THIS FILE. Do not change the name of this file. Changing the name of this file or moving it wil cause Windows to no longer work on your machine.

If you have problems or difficulties, please bring your machine and Windows CD's to the iCare Corner.
